Glover, participating in the City of Augusta Voluntary Acquisition Program (the "Seller") and the City of Augusta, Georgia(the"City"), its successors and assigns: WHEREAS, the City of Augusta has approved a budget, from SPLOST funding, for the acquisition of structures in the floodplain, to demolish and/or remove the structures, and to maintain the use of the Property as open space in perpetuity in order to protect and preserve natural floodplain values. Now,therefore,the grant is made subject to the following terms and conditions: 1. Terms. The following conditions and restrictions shall apply in perpetuity to the Property described in the attached deed and acquired by the City of Augusta pursuant to FEMA program requirements concerning the acquisition of property for open space: a. Compatible uses. The Property shall be dedicated and maintained in perpetuity as open space for the conservation of natural floodplain functions. Such uses may include: parks for outdoor recreational activities; wetlands management; nature reserves; cultivation; grazing; camping (except where adequate warning time is not available to allow evacuation); unimproved, unpaved parking lots; buffer zones, Riparian areas; and other uses consistent with floor reduction. b. Structures. No new structures or improvements shall be erected on the Property other than: i. A public facility that is open on all sides and functionally related to a designated open space or recreational use; ii. A public rest room that has been flood proofed or designed to flood; or iii. A structure that is compatible with open space and conserves the natural function of the floodplain. Any improvements on the Property shall be in accordance with proper floodplain management policies and practices. Structures built on the Property according to paragraph b. of this section shall be flood proofed or elevated to at least the base flood level plus 3 foot of freeboard. c. Disaster Assistance and Flood Insurance. No Federal entity or source may provide disaster assistance for any purpose with respect to the Property, nor may any application for such assistance be made to any Federal entity or source. The Property is not eligible for coverage under the NFIP for damage to structures on the property occurring after the date of the property settlement, except for pre-existing structures being relocated off the property as a result of the project. d. Transfer. The City, including successors in interest, shall convey any interest in the Property to any other party, unless it is for the furtherance of management of the natural floodplain, such as a qualified conservation organization. However,the City of Augusta may convey as easement or lease to a private individual or entity for purposes compatible with the uses described in paragraph i, of this section so long as the conveyance does not include authority to control and enforce the terms and conditions of this section and said easement/lease being subject to a conservation easement that shall be recorded with the easement/ lease and shall incorporate all terms and conditions set forth in this section, including the easement/ lease holder's responsibility to enforce the easement. This shall be accomplished by one of the following means: i. The City of Augusta shall convey, in accordance with this paragraph, a conservation easement to an entity other than the title holder, which shall be recorded with the deed, or ii. At the time of title transfer, the City of Augusta shall retain such conservation easement, and record it with the deed. Conveyance/lease of any property interest must reference and incorporate the original deed restrictions providing notice of the conditions in this section and must incorporate a provision for the property interest to revert back to the City of Augusta in the event that the transferee/leasee ceases to exist or loses its eligible status under this section. •*.. • Inspection. The City of Augusta shall have the right to enter upon the Property, at reasonable times and with reasonable notice, for the purpose of inspecting the Property to ensure compliance with the terms of the Property conveyance/lease. Monitoring and Reporting.
